Councils across UK approve new 20mph speed limits

News summary

Various councils across the UK are implementing new 20mph speed limits to enhance road safety and promote alternative modes of transportation. In Bicester, Oxfordshire County Council is consulting on extending 20mph limits in residential areas due to safety concerns raised by local authorities, with the consultation closing in February 2025. Leicester City Council is also moving forward with plans to introduce 20mph zones in six neighborhoods, aiming to reduce accidents and improve air quality, with an estimated cost of £113,000. Similarly, Dudley Council has approved 20mph speed limits in its town center to address safety issues, particularly around schools and pedestrian visibility. In Trowse, Norfolk, a traffic regulation order is finally being applied to enforce a previously unregulated 20mph limit established in 2021. These initiatives reflect a broader commitment to creating safer and more pedestrian-friendly environments in urban areas.
